This was written by an unhappy language-arts student.
The door-monitor said, "Why did you go out without permission?" and beat me. The water-monitor said, "Why did you take water without my permission?" and beat me. The Sumerian monitor said, "You spoke in Akkadian!" and beat me. My teacher said, "Your handwriting is not at all good!" and beat me. The man in charge of neatness said, "You loitered in the street and didn’t keep your clothes straight!" and beat me. The man in charge of silence said, "Why did you talk without permission?" and beat me . . . So I began to hate the scribal art and neglect the scribal art. My teacher took no delight in me.
